Discovering the Rich History of Sudan Map In Africa
One of the main draws of Sudan is its rich history. The country is home to some of the most impressive ancient ruins in the world, including the pyramids of Meroe. These pyramids are smaller and more numerous than the pyramids in Egypt, and they offer a glimpse into a fascinating ancient civilization that is often overlooked.
Experiencing the Vibrant Culture of Sudan Map In Africa
Another highlight of traveling to Sudan is experiencing the vibrant local culture. Sudan is a diverse country with over 500 ethnic groups, and each has its own unique customs and traditions. One of the best ways to experience local culture is to visit the markets, where you can find everything from traditional handicrafts to delicious local cuisine.

Q: What is the best time of year to visit Sudan?
A: The best time to visit Sudan is during the winter months (December-February) when the weather is cooler and more comfortable for sightseeing.
Q: What is the local currency in Sudan?
A: The local currency in Sudan is the Sudanese pound (SDG).
Q: What is the main language spoken in Sudan?
A: The main language spoken in Sudan is Arabic, but English is also widely spoken.
